WebFree for Open Source Application Security Tools - OWASP page that lists the Commercial Dynamic Application Security Testing (DAST) tools we know of that are free for Open Source http://sectooladdict.blogspot.com/ - Web Application Vulnerability Scanner Evaluation Project (WAVSEP) WebOpen source software (OSS) is software that is distributed with its source code, making it available for use, modification, and distribution with its original rights. Source code is the part of software that most computer users don’t ever see; it’s the code computer programmers manipulate to control how a program or application behaves.
